
NEW WORLD CUISINE
LIGHT, HEALTHY, TROPICAL, AND FULL OF FLAVOR
Norman Van Aken is given credit for coining the name NEW WORLD CUISINE back in 1986. Other names are Florida Fusion or Floribbean, and simply stated it is A CUISINE THAT MARRIES CLASSIC COOKING WITH "NEW WORLD" INGREDIENTS, referring to Christopher Columbus's NEW WORLD discovery in 1492. Some of these New World Ingredients are: BANANAS, PLANTAINS, VANILLA BEAN and TROPICAL FRUITS SUCH AS MANGO, CARAMBOLA, KIWI and PASSIONFRUIT. Additionally, the foods of the NEW WORLD included spices such as CINNAMON, CUMIN, CAYENNE, and CORIANDER.

Banana-Mango Chutney
Servings: 6
2 cups of diced mango
2 Tbsp minced cilantro
1 cup of finely diced red pepper
˝ tsp diced chipotle peppers
1 cup diced red onion
3 ounces apple cider vinegar
2 ounces sugar
1 teaspoon cumin
2 cups of diced banana
Simmer all ingredients except
The bananas and cilantro together
For 10 minutes. When cool add bananas
And Cilantro and put on your favorite
Blackened fish, Chicken or Steak.
New World Thoughts
ˇ A lot of great recipes are easily adapted by substituting New World Ingredients in the recipe.
ˇ Fry thinly sliced Green Plantains in vegetable oil for a crisp chip perfect for a New World Dip.
ˇ Substitute Boniatos for any Potato recipe for a sweeter almost chestnut flavor.
ˇ Make a simple Mojo by combining equal parts lime juice, orange juice and olive oil flavored with cumin, garlic, salt and pepper. Put atop salad or vegetables or a pied of grilled pork, chicken or fish.
